Description
A watching brief was maintained during groundworks following the collapse of part of the churchyard wall. Two test pits were dug by the groundworks contractor against the south wall of the church to establish the depth of natural deposits, and observed by archaeologists. Digging of a new pipe trench was also observed. Both revealed topsoil over a redeposited brown clay.
